CENTER, a nonprofit organization based in Santa Fe, New Mexico, supports photographic and lens-based artists by offering direct funding, exhibition opportunities, professional development, and publication features. In 2025, CENTER is providing $16,000 in funding, a group exhibition, access to the Review Santa Fe portfolio reviews, and features in LENSCRATCH. Information & Application Details: Early […]
Brief Description La Napoule Art Foundation (LNAF) offers multiple artist residencies to foster cultural exchange and artistic creation. The program provides selected artists with accommodation, studio space, and most meals in a historic setting in France. The Fondation Fiminco, in collaboration with the Taiwan Cultural Center in Paris, invites applications from Taiwanese artists specializing in new media and digital art for a 4-month funded residency in Romainville, France. This residency provides artists with research, creation, and production opportunities within an international artistic community, offering professional mentorship and state-of-the-art facilities.
